AOC Addresses Death Threats Following Offensive Baseball Video Controversy
Representative Alexandria Ocasio-Cortez (AOC) has publicly addressed the surge in death threats she received following a controversial video depicting a baseball game. The video, which sparked outrage across social media, featured a graphic depiction of violence against political figures, including AOC. This incident highlights the escalating dangers faced by elected officials in the current political climate and underscores the urgent need for stronger measures to combat online harassment and threats.
The video, widely circulated online, showed a simulated baseball game where figures resembling prominent Democrats were targeted. The graphic nature of the video immediately ignited a firestorm of criticism, with many condemning its violent and dehumanizing portrayal of political opponents. AOC, a frequent target of online abuse, was quick to respond to the incident, expressing her deep concern about the escalating threats to her safety and the safety of other public figures.
A Pattern of Online Harassment and Violence
This latest incident is unfortunately not an isolated event. AOC has consistently been a target of online harassment and abuse, facing a constant barrage of hateful messages, threats, and misinformation campaigns. The severity of these threats has steadily increased, with some reaching levels that constitute credible threats of violence. This pattern is not unique to AOC; many other elected officials, particularly women and minority representatives, experience similar levels of online abuse.
- Increased Security Concerns: The rise in death threats has forced AOC and her staff to significantly increase security measures. This includes increased police protection, enhanced online monitoring, and a greater focus on threat assessment.
- Mental Health Impact: The constant barrage of abuse takes a significant toll on the mental health of elected officials and their families. The psychological stress associated with living under the constant threat of violence is undeniable.
- The Role of Social Media: Social media platforms bear a significant responsibility in addressing this issue. The ease with which hateful content can be spread and amplified online makes it a breeding ground for extremism and violence. Calls for stronger moderation policies and increased accountability for social media companies are growing louder.
Calls for Accountability and Reform
AOC’s response to the baseball video controversy has prompted a renewed call for stronger action to combat online harassment and threats against public figures. Many are advocating for:
- Stricter laws: Increased penalties for online harassment and credible threats of violence.
- Improved platform policies: Social media companies need to implement more effective measures to identify, remove, and prevent the spread of harmful content.
- Increased mental health support: Providing better access to mental health resources for elected officials and their staff.
- Promoting respectful discourse: A renewed focus on fostering civil and respectful dialogue in the public sphere.
The incident involving the offensive baseball video serves as a stark reminder of the dangers faced by public figures in today's polarized political climate. The need for stronger measures to protect elected officials from online harassment and violence is undeniable, and the conversation around accountability and reform must continue. The safety and well-being of our elected representatives is crucial for a functioning democracy. AOC's courageous decision to speak out about these threats is a critical step in raising awareness and pushing for much-needed change.
